Tarnowitzite is a rare lead-rich varietal of aragonite (it is also called plumboan aragonite), here represented in a large, rich, striking and actually rather PRETTY specimen from the classic Tsumeb locality. Tarnowitzite is actually a mixture of aragonite and cerussite. The crystals here are not only superbly formed, but EXTREMELY lustrous; they stretch completely across the matrix from side to side.
